磁力搜索神器magnetW:一键聚合23个资源站的完整搜索指南
磁力搜索神器magnetW:一键聚合23个资源站的完整搜索指南
【免费下载链接】magnetW[已失效,不再维护]项目地址: https://gitcode.com/gh_mirrors/ma/magnetW
还在为寻找资源而苦恼吗?你是否曾在十几个种子网站间来回切换,只为找到最合适的下载链接?magnetW正是为解决这一痛点而生的开源磁力链接聚合工具。它通过整合23个主流资源站点,让资源搜索变得前所未有的简单高效。无论是学习资料、影视资源还是软件工具,只需一个关键词,就能获得全网聚合结果。
你可能遇到的资源搜索挑战
在数字化时代,信息获取效率直接影响学习和工作效率。传统资源搜索方式存在几个明显痛点:
多平台切换的繁琐:每个资源站都有不同的界面和搜索规则,用户需要记住多个网站的网址和操作方式,浪费大量时间在平台切换上。
搜索结果分散不全面:单一站点的搜索结果往往有限,可能错过其他平台上的优质资源,需要手动对比多个站点的结果。
技术门槛限制:一些专业资源站可能需要特殊网络环境或技术配置,普通用户难以充分利用所有可用资源。
搜索结果质量参差不齐:不同站点的资源质量、更新速度和可用性差异很大,用户难以快速筛选出最佳选择。
专家提示:magnetW的设计理念就是解决这些痛点,通过技术手段将分散的资源聚合到一个界面中,让用户专注于内容本身而非搜索过程。
如何快速上手这款磁力聚合工具
环境准备与安装步骤
开始使用magnetW非常简单,只需几个简单步骤:
获取项目代码:使用git克隆项目到本地
git clone https://gitcode.com/gh_mirrors/ma/magnetW进入项目目录:
cd magnetW安装依赖:
npm install启动应用:
npm run dev
验证安装成功的简单方法:应用启动后,检查界面左侧是否显示完整的源站列表,顶部搜索框能否正常输入关键词。如果看到"成功刷新23个规则"的提示,说明所有搜索源都已准备就绪。
界面布局与核心功能解析
magnetW的界面设计简洁直观,分为三个主要区域:
左侧源站选择区:这里列出了所有可用的资源站点,包括"种子搜"、"idope"、"BTSOW"、"BT蚂蚁"、"BT4G"等23个专业站点。每个站点都有独特的图标标识,右侧的绿色图标表示当前可用状态。你可以根据资源类型灵活勾选特定站点组合。
顶部搜索导航区:中央的搜索框支持关键词输入,右侧的放大镜图标启动搜索。导航菜单包含"首页"、"设置"、"文档中心"三个选项,方便用户在不同功能间切换。
主内容展示区:搜索结果按"收录时间"、"文件大小"、"下载人气"三个维度排序。在无搜索时,这里会显示常见问题解答和应用说明,帮助用户快速上手。
高效搜索策略:专家教你这样用
针对不同资源类型的搜索技巧
学术资料与学习教程搜索:
- 使用"收录时间"排序,优先显示最新更新的内容
- 结合精确关键词,如"Python数据分析 2023教程"
- 重点选择"BT4G"、"BTDB"等学术资源丰富的站点
高清影视资源搜索:
- 利用"文件大小"筛选功能,快速定位高清版本
- 输入具体分辨率要求,如"星球大战 4K 蓝光"
- 优先选择"种子搜"、"BTSOW"等影视资源集中的站点
软件工具搜索:
- 关注"下载人气"排序,选择热门可靠的版本
- 包含版本号和系统要求,如"Photoshop 2023 Windows"
- 使用"idope"、"磁力宝"等软件资源较多的站点
个性化配置提升搜索体验
magnetW支持多种个性化设置来优化搜索体验:
源站管理:在左侧面板勾选常用站点,点击"记住选择"保存偏好设置。这样每次启动时都会自动加载你习惯使用的站点组合。
代理配置:对于某些需要特殊网络环境的站点,可以在设置中配置HTTP代理。配置参数保存在src/renderer/plugins/localsetting.js文件中,支持多种代理协议。
搜索结果过滤:通过编辑rule.json文件,可以自定义站点规则或添加新的搜索源。高级用户还可以通过正则表达式优化资源提取逻辑,提升结果准确性。
技术架构:了解背后的工作原理
智能调度与并发控制
magnetW的核心调度模块位于src/main/service.js,它采用智能任务队列机制管理搜索请求。系统会自动控制并发请求数量,避免因同时访问过多站点导致IP被限制。这种设计既保证了搜索速度,又确保了网络使用的稳定性。
统一结果处理机制
不同资源站返回的数据格式各异,magnetW通过src/main/format-parser.js模块将所有结果标准化处理。这个模块能将各种HTML结构转换为统一的JSON格式,让用户看到的搜索结果具有一致的显示方式。
双层缓存加速技术
为了提升重复搜索的响应速度,magnetW实现了双层缓存系统:
- 内存缓存:
src/main/memory-cache.js负责存储热门搜索结果,提供毫秒级响应 - 文件缓存:
src/main/electron-cache.js将常用数据持久化存储,减少网络请求
跨平台兼容性设计
基于Electron框架构建,magnetW天然支持Windows、macOS和Linux三大主流操作系统。前端采用Vue.js开发,界面组件集中在src/renderer/components/目录,确保了良好的用户体验和响应速度。
常见问题与解决方案
搜索结果为空怎么办?
问题分析:输入关键词后没有返回任何结果可能有多种原因。
排查步骤:
- 点击界面"刷新"按钮更新站点规则
- 检查网络连接状态,确保可以访问外部资源
- 尝试切换不同的搜索站点组合
- 简化关键词或使用更通用的搜索词重试
专家建议:某些站点可能需要特殊网络环境,可在"设置"页面配置HTTP代理。如果问题持续,可以检查src/main/repository.js中的规则更新机制是否正常工作。
如何备份个性化配置?
解决方案:magnetW的配置文件位于src/renderer/plugins/localsetting.js,定期备份此文件即可保留所有个性化设置,包括:
- 站点偏好选择
- 代理服务器配置
- 界面显示设置
- 搜索结果排序偏好
实用技巧:建议将配置文件同步到云存储服务,这样可以在不同设备间共享个性化设置,实现无缝切换。
应用启动失败的处理方法
常见原因:
- 依赖包安装不完整
- 端口被占用
- 系统环境不兼容
解决步骤:
- 重新安装依赖:
npm install --no-optional - 检查端口占用情况
- 查看系统日志获取详细错误信息
资源使用伦理与注意事项
合法合规使用:magnetW作为开源工具,仅用于技术交流和学习目的。搜索结果均来自公开资源站点,用户应遵守当地法律法规,尊重知识产权,确保所有下载内容用于个人学习研究。
安全提醒:项目明确声明没有任何官方群组,所有技术交流都在开源平台进行。其他渠道获取的版本可能存在安全风险,请仔细辨别来源。
技术学习价值:通过研究magnetW的源代码,开发者可以学习到:
- 多源数据聚合的实现方式
- Electron桌面应用开发技巧
- Vue.js前端框架的最佳实践
- 网络爬虫与数据解析技术
总结:让技术回归工具本质
magnetW的真正价值不仅在于聚合搜索功能,更在于它让用户能够专注于内容本身而非搜索过程。通过合理配置和使用这款工具,你可以将更多时间投入到有价值的学习和创造中。
记住,技术工具的力量在于恰当使用。始终保持对知识产权的尊重和对法律法规的遵守,才能让技术真正服务于我们的学习与生活。开源项目的意义在于分享与进步,magnetW为资源搜索提供了一个优雅的技术解决方案,期待更多开发者在此基础上创造更多可能性。
【免费下载链接】magnetW[已失效,不再维护]项目地址: https://gitcode.com/gh_mirrors/ma/magnetW
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考